Pescando SEO con FLASH

23

En este artículo, vamos a ver algunas soluciones para Posicionar Flash en Buscadores o SEO para Flash o directamente Flash para Google, con algunos datos interesantes resultado de una charla en Foros del Web.

Hace unos días en Foros del Web discutiamos conversábamos sobre posicionamiento de sitios Flash en buscadores o SEO con Flash.

Posicionamiento de sitios Flash

Al realizar mi primera intervención, la charla se torno un poco dura, ya que como gran parte de mi vida es virtual y me siento como Pez en el agua en los pocos foros donde participo, y no puedo evitar mi humor ácido, el cual a veces cuando no me conocen no es bien recibido, pero afortunadamente me ha hecho ganar buenos amigos.

Mi postura a secas, es que Flash no se puede posicionar y explicaré porque pienso así más adelante.

En el post se menciono mucha información interesante, como por ejemplo un sitio que tiene todo lo que no se debe hacer.

Nunca escribas simbolos en los titulos de tus paginas
<TITLE> \ . Bienvenidos a Dj Marta.com . / .</TITLE>

No utilices frames en tus paginas
<frameset rows = «*,571,*» framespacing = «0» frameborder = «no» scrolling =»YES»>

Para posicionarla, tu web debe tener contenido
<BODY bgcolor=»#D5E0E6″ leftmargin=»0″ topmargin=»0″ marginwidth=»0″ marginheight=»0″ class=»barra»></body>

Pero según el usuario que preguntaba, salia Primero en las búsquedas, según mi búsqueda de la palabra «DJ», ese sitio no sale primero, pero sale bastante bien posicionado, para hacer todo lo que no se debe hacer, y la razón, es que tiene otras paginas Html bastante bien indexadas y concurridas.

También se menciono SWFObject, como alternativa positiva para realizar posicionamiento Flash. Este script, comienza a tener sentido cuando el programa para ver webs Internet Explorer, no puede mostrar Flash directamente, y SWFObject elimina el antiestetico recuadro de contenido Activex.

Pero la evolución de SWFObjetc, agrega la posibilidad de indicar contenido alternativo, por si alguien no puede ver el Flash, y en concordancia con los estándares de Accesibilidad.

Esto significa, que aparte del Flash SWF podemos agregar un equivalente de contenido HTML, que es lo que los buscadores van a leer y posicionar, por tanto, SWFObject se ve como una alternativa al posicionamiento.

Otros links interesantes fueron:

How to SEO Flash, que propone agregar a nuestro SWF contenido alternativo y adicional en HTML.

21 trucos SEO según Matt Cutts, donde dice algo como «si utilizas Flash, haz una versión alternativa HTML y bloquea la versión Flash con robots.txt»

Entrevista a Matt Cutts en Pubcon, donde le preguntan sobre el status de Google respecto a la lectura de contenido Flash SWF, y el sugiere que el SDK de adobe  es una buena alternativa.

SDK Adobe para Buscadores, es el que mencionaba Matt Cutts, y permite mejorar el posicionamiento de Flash en buscadores, tiene algunas cositas interesante, una de ellas el swf2html, que permite generar código HTML a partir de nuestro SWF, publicado ese HTML los buscadores posicionan mejor ese contenido alterno de Flash.

A esa altura era obvio que ninguna empresa conocida, o grande utilizaría Flash en sus sitios, incluso un usuario se animo a decirlo.

Empresas o Marcas conocidas que usan Flash

http://pepsi.com/

http://www.nike.com/

http://www.coca-cola.com/

http://disney.com/

http://www.puma.com/

El tema, es que Flash es bueno para muchas cosas, no es que no lo vayas a utilizar, mi punto es que no se puede posicionar en buscadores. Pero quien va a buscar Nike, Coke, Pepsi, Puma en Google antes de intentar poner el nombre.com ?, ellos no necesitan aparecer primero en Google, de hecho si buscas «pepsi» sale primero wikipedia definiendo lo que es pepsi 😛

A esa altura estaba todo casi dicho, aunque este debate siempre quedará abierto y seguramente la tecnología y las opiniones cambien en poco o mucho tiempo, solo quedaba un ejemplo gráfico y esa es la imagen inicial adjunta a este artículo.

La Ilustración:

Es obvio que con Flash, podemos tener una letra de titulo mejor que verdana, a los elementos naturales para acceder al lago, podemos crearle una zona empedrada para no mojarnos los pies, y obviamente prevenir una patinada, e incluso algunos le agregan hasta un trampolín, y otros mas expertos en el uso de esta tecnología protegen a los peces de su estanque con 2 placas térmicas, y que estén calentitos, con todo eso quizás con suerte el anzuelo llega a la segunda capa protectora térmica.

Pero a mi manera de ver, con HTML, no hay nada mejor que echarse para atrás, y que mi modesta caña llegue directo, respirar el aroma de los pastitos, y llegar mas rápido a lo que yo buscaba que eran los peces 😉

Y en algunos casos, todos leen en HTML «pescando con html y CSS», pero se les pasa tanto la mano en la decoración, efectos y diseño con Flash, que algunos piden que se aclare que dice en el titulo, y si estuviera en verdana se podría leer «pescando con flash».

Conclusión:

Queda pendiente explicar porque digo que Flash no se puede posicionar, pero si leiste este artículo, o miras rapidamente para comprobarlo, para posicionar Flash, debes posicionar el contenido alterno en HTML






Loading Facebook Comments ...

23 comentarios para “Pescando SEO con FLASH”

  1. Carla says:

    Entendido Sr., posicionaremos el contenido alterno en html a ver si pescamos alguna buena corvina 😛

  2. «me siento como Pez en el agua en los pocos foros donde participo, y no puedo evitar mi humor ácido, el cual a veces cuando no me conocen no es bien recibido, pero afortunadamente me ha hecho ganar buenos amigos.»

    Jorge sos un tipo que ayuda y lamentablemente eso se malentiende.. no sé por qué.. naturaleza humana quizás. Yo me siento tu amigo y es por como sos. Te quiero loco!

  3. Aclaraste el punto. Pero no entiendo porque dibujas con el pie izquierdo 😛

  4. davichas says:

    de hecho si buscas “pepsi” sale primero wikipedia definiendo lo que es pepsi

    no es cierto.

  5. elQuique says:

    davichas, es una metáfora, igualmente no sale pepsi.com en el buscador google.com, no lo he probado en los regionales, utilice el español e ingles internacional.

    • Tadeo says:

      Hola Jorge,
      trabajo en flash desde hace años y te puedo decir que tiene las mismas limitaciones para posicionamiento que Ajax y Web 2.0.
      Hay que abordar y planificar específicamente el tema de SEO para un sitio como se debe hacer con Ajax. Existen formas de hacerlo y la clave está, como siempre, en separar el contenido de la visualización. No es necesario, con las tecnologías actuales, hacer una versión alternativa en HTML para lograr un buen posicionamiento.

      Por otro lado, es cierto lo que dice davichas: buscando «pepsi» en google no sale primero la wikipedia.

      – en la versión .com en inglés sale pepsi.com
      http://www.google.com/search?hl=en&q=pepsi

      – en la versión .com en español sale pepsi.es
      http://www.google.com/search?hl=es&q=pepsi

      – en la versión .com.uy sale pepsi.com.uy
      http://www.google.com.uy/search?hl=es&q=pepsi

      En cualquier caso, más allá de ser un argumento falso, no serviría como argumento para la charla porque no estamos, en este ejemplo en concreto, buscando contenido.

      Leyendo este post y algún otro de este sitio me preguntaba qué experiencia tienes de trabajo práctico en el tema (con o sin Flash) con resultados reales, más allá del conocimiento académico de lo que estudias y de lo que lees en la web. Entré en http://www.creativaint.com buscando una respuesta a esto y no hay links.
      ¿Hay algún sitio que hayas hecho donde podamos ver puestas en prácticas las ideas que promulgas?

      Muchas gracias, saludos.

      • Tadeo, no, no es lo mismo hacer un sitio en HTML que hacerlo en Flash, por más experiencia que tengas en realizar sitios Flash, no es lo mismo. Sería interesante que leas un poco a Google y Adobe, para que entiendas la diferencia.

        Sobre buscar Pepsi, fue un ejemplo, y lo aclaré en otro comentario, por otra parte, si buscas «Jorge Oyhenard», sale mi blog ??, pues claro, si así me llamo :), lo mismo sucede con Pepsi, si buscas Pepsi, o Coca Cola, sale, en cambio que pasa si buscas Refresco, porque no sale Pepsi primero si yo quiero tomar un refresco ??

        Sobre mi experiencia, no no la tengo, solo hice este blog y el sitio de creativa sin links porque no tengo experiencia, pero estoy aprendiendo 😉

        Y en tu caso, en cual sitio puedo conocer tu práctica y experiencia para rebatir las ideas que promulgo ?

        Busqué Tadeo en Google y no me dice mucho. Igualmente si encontré tu portfolio por el dominio de tu email, y vi sitios Full Flash, y está bien que defiendas eso, de hecho están algunos bien realizados en cuanto a lo estético, pero si tienes esa experiencia y haz leído un poco, solo un poco, o probado algo solo algo, sabrás de lo que hablo en este artículo 🙂

        • Tadeo says:

          Está más que claro que no es lo mismo hacer un sitio en HTML que hacerlo en Flash.
          Lo que dije es que para lograr una buena SEO para un sitio hecho en Flash se debe planificar y abordar el tema al igual que para un sitio hecho en Ajax. Lo que tienen en común ambas tecnologías (cuando están bien trabajadas) es la carga dinámica de los contenidos. En el caso de Ajax la carga se hace mediante Javascript, que Google aún no interpreta, y allí está su limitación.
          Para abordar esto se debe planificar y programar el site de manera de ofrecer a Google un acceso directo al mismo contenido (http://searchengineland.com/google-offers-seo-advice-on-ajax-coding-12637).
          Esto mismo vale para Flash. Un ejemplo muy simple (que hice hace un par de años) que puedes probar:
          http://www.google.com.uy/search?q=sugarloaf+uruguay+enchanted+rock+spa+wellness+center

          Por supuesto, que Google indexe el contenido de un site no te asegura un buen posicionamiento. Ese es un asunto que implica otro tipo de trabajo más orientado al contenido que a la tecnología que utilices y lo tendrás que hacer también si trabajas con Ajax.
          Actualmente estoy trabajando en deeplinking y SEO en flash y hay avances muy interesantes de la misma gente de Asual (los creadores de SWFObject). La herramienta que están haciendo también facilita la implementación de deeplinking en Ajax: http://www.asual.com/swfaddress/
          Recomiendo enormemente pegar una mirada a esto último.
          Espero haber aportado a una conversación que, desde mi punto de vista, continúa bastante cargada de prejuicios.

          • Bueno a eso mismo iba este artículo, si miras el comienzo nació en una charla en Foros del Web, y claro tiene bastante de nuestra experiencia en el tema, hemos posicionado contenidos en Flash y HTML.

            Igualmente, si considero que un sitio Full Flash hoy día es algo obsoleto y solo utilizable para algunos contenidos específicos.

            En cuanto a lo que dices de AJAX, no entiendo bien a lo que vas, peros si realizas un sitio en HTML y CSS, y luego aplicas AJAX no intrusivo respetando Accesibilidad, los buscadores ni se enteran que usaste AJAX.

            Tanto en Flash como en JavaScript si bien Google puede ahora seguir los links, como digo en este otro artículo: SEO para Flash no puede ejecutar consultas, por ejemplo si haces un e-commerce con Flash o AJAX donde cada producto se muestre luego de una acción de consulta, obviamente Google no va a ver todos los productos.

            El Flash y el JavaScript o abuso de AJAX sigue siendo una mala practica de cara al SEO, aunque en la practica de cara al usuario pueda o no mejorar la interacción con el contenido.

            Es cuestión de planificar, pero siempre es mejor un HTML y CSS plano, o bien un uso AJAX no instrusivo, aun antes que hacer un Full Flash, que sigue siendo en parte una caja negra.

            Igualmente como tu dices, y digo en este y en el artículo SEO para Flash, no es lo mismo indexar que posicionar, y ahí es justamente donde sitios Full Flash no compiten, no puedes posicionarlos porque no tienes control del contenido.

            Y por último te aclaro que no son prejuicios, es solo experiencia en las tres plataformas: Flash, Ajax, HTML

  6. Tu labor es bastante loable y valiosos tus aportes a la comunidad internauta. Siempre apoyo y aplaudo la transmisión de conocimientos de manera limpia y desinteresada. Recibe saludos de Agrelsoft desde el Perú.

  7. kitsch says:

    Aunque soy flashero de corazón, te doy completa razón; no he visto aun una solución real para SEO con flash, lo que hace que muchos de los que nos dedicamos al flash tengamos poco trabajo jejeje… ya en serio, flash es increiblemente bueno para muchas cosas, pero hasta el momento no para SEO, haber si en futuro con las nuevas aplicaciones ya esto cambia, de momento a usarlo solo lo necesario.

  8. <span class="topsy_trackback_comment"><span class="topsy_twitter_username"><span class="topsy_trackback_content">@ErnestoGraf jaja para que sepas, mi obra de pescando seo con flash trascendio fronteras http://bit.ly/16QHpO (me lo han copiao por rss)</span></span>

  9. Optimizando sitios Flash para SEO http://bit.ly/uf3n0
    #seo #flash

  10. Neri Aispuro says:

    RT: @elQuique: Optimizando sitios Flash para SEO http://bit.ly/uf3n0 #seo #flash

  11. SpamLoco says:

    «trabajo en flash desde hace años y te puedo decir que tiene las mismas limitaciones para posicionamiento que Ajax y Web 2.0»

    :S

  12. Tadeo says:

    Hola Jorge,
    qué pena que ahora no se puede hacer Reply en tu respuesta.
    Es divertido que digas que no son prejuicios sino que es experiencia en las tres plataformas cuando me habías dicho que no tenías ni un sitio para mostrar hecho por vos, que estabas aprendiendo.
    Sobre lo de Ajax, simplemente te digo que para que Google ni se entere que usás Ajax e indexe bien la página le tenés que dar alternativas para llegar a los contenidos que cargás en la página por Javascript, pues no lo interpreta. Esto lo he tenido que aplicar en los sitios que he hecho con Ajax, al igual que en el ejemplo que te mandé en Flash.
    Te recomiendo ver el tema de SWFaddress de la gente de Asual, aporta soluciones para SEO en Ajax.
    Me apena pero entiendo que no quieras continuar dialogando sobre el tema públicamente.
    Un abrazo,
    Tadeo

  13. Me reboto tu email, pero ya agregue tu mensaje, mi respuesta era:

    Aaa debe ser por el nivel, solo admite 3 o 4 niveles anidados de respuesta. Agrega la respuesta al final 😉 , así queda en el blog.

    Lo de que estoy aprendiendo fue broma, obviamente. Agrega tu respuesta en el blog al final de los comentarios, igual se entenderá de que venimos charlando, aunque no hagas reply.

    Agrego, que obviamente no tengo problemas de discutir públicamente, solo elimino los post que insultan, ponen porno, o spam.

    Y no lo hago por reprimir, si no porque me gusta contestar y no tiene sentido contestar en esos casos 🙂

  14. Busca en Google «SEO para Flash» y encuentras este artículo, artículo donde muchos Flasheros buscando SEO para Flash, llegan buscando eso, y aun así, no entienden 🙂

    Casi todos nuestros sitios, tiene un enfoque SEO, ya que como son en Internet, nos interesa que nos visiten, y para visitarnos deben encontrarnos.

  15. SpamLoco says:

    Más arriba hay citan un ejemplo, sugarloafuruguay.com que a mi me parece que no tiene un buen SEO aplicado.

    No hay URL canónicas.

    Las URL no son amiables, son algo así: » sugarloafuruguay.com/home.php?id=enchanted_rock_spa&lang=en «, cuando podrían ser: » sugarloafuruguay.com/enchanted-reock-spa… etc » se posicionaría mejor, creo yo 🙂

    Además esa sección al parecer se llama, ENCHANTED ROCK SPA & WELLNESS CENTER y en Google me cuesta encontrarla por el título
    http://www.google.com/#hl=en&q=ENCHANTED+ROCK+SPA+%26+WELLNESS+CENTER&aq=f&oq=&aqi=&fp=leBsIIJAIN0

    Lo mismo si busco una parte del texto

    http://www.google.com/#hl=en&q=A+single+moment+of+bliss+colors+all+the+moments+to+follow.+While+our+therapists+and+aestheticians+bestow+their+expert+&aq=f&oq=&aqi=&fp=leBsIIJAIN0

    Y al estar el sitio en flash, no me resultan amigables las URL, parece la web de Antel… estoy en » sugarloafuruguay.com/home.php?id=enchanted_rock_spa&lang=en » pero cambio de contenidos totalmente en la pantalla, en realidad estoy acá » http://www.sugarloafuruguay.com/home.php?id=marina&lang=en » pero la URL en el navegador sigue siendo la primera. Si la quiero compartir no voy a poder, o al menos se me va a complicar.

    Los efectos, las imágenes y la galería quedan muy lindas en flash… pero se pierden visitas desde Google, para llegar al sitio prácticamente tengo que conocer el nombre de la empresa y agregar la palabra uruguay.

    Ahora, pensando en lo que dice Jorge en el post… se podría lograr algo igual de atractivo con CSS y HTML, bueno en realidad no porque flash es flash, pero si muy parecido, usable y que además se posiciona mucho mejor.

    Bueno, es lo que me parece a mí… analizando ese sitio ya que estaba, son las 5 am y en realidad yo hable de atrevido 😀

  16. Si, no me queda muy claro a que vino ese ejemplo, si fue a indexarlo está bien, pero este artículo hablaba de SEO, y si para encontrar el sitio debemos buscar algo tan específico como:

    sugarloaf uruguay enchanted rock spa wellness center

    no tiene mucho sentido.

    Pero igualmente, aun así, si hablamos solo de la indexación, cuando buscamos: http://www.google.com.uy/search?q=site:sugarloafuruguay.com

    Vemos que muchas páginas, que supuestamente son diferentes, tienen todas el mismo titulo, incluso el titulo en algunos caso roza el keyword stuffing.

    Además, viendo detenidamente el sitio, por ejemplo en:

    http://www.sugarloafuruguay.com/home.php?id=why_uruguay&lang=en

    lo que posiciona e indexa no es el Flash, es texto oculto HTML, ocultado con CSS:

    .index_data {
    	height: 1px;
    	overflow: hidden;
    }
    

    La página también carece de H1, H2, y salta en un H4, va contra SEO y también contra la semántica y accesibilidad.

    Pero en definitiva, reitero la parte final de mi artículo:

    Conclusión:
    Queda pendiente explicar porque digo que Flash no se puede posicionar, pero si leíste este artículo, o miras rápidamente para comprobarlo, para posicionar Flash, debes posicionar el contenido alterno en HTML

  17. @Fedelosa @porteseo a mi me encantan las webs flash son lo best 🙂 http://bit.ly/a3N40m

  18. Pescando SEO con FLASH http://bit.ly/16QHpO SEO para Flash http://bit.ly/uHlPr #seo #flash

Dejar un comentario